I've recently been cast in a local production of this show, but wanted to get a head-start on my lines before the rehearsal materials came in. After comparing this with the licensed materials that came from MTI, they scripts are identical (save a few words here and there). No major changes have been made to the script. The best part about owning my own copy is that I can high light and mark it up without having to worry about sending it back after the show is over. There are also some black and white pictures from multiple productions of the show, as well as lists of major productions and available soundtracks included in this book. This is the paperback libretto of Stephen Sondheim's A LITTLE NIGHT MUSIC (1973), authored by the late Hugh Wheeler. (It is not to be confused with the piano score or vocal score of the musical, available separately, some of whose reviews have, unfortunately, wound up at this site). I need hardly say that A LITTLE NIGHT MUSIC is a marvelous play based on Ingmar Bergman's 1955 film SMILES OF A SUMMER NIGHT. This book contains the text of Sondheim's songs as they occur within the play, and dovetails nicely with the cast album (Little Night Music). Numeous bells and whistles make this book not only appropriate but downright enjoyable, including a vintage Hirschfeld reproduction of most of the Broadway show's principals (among them Len Cariou, Glynis Johns and Hermione Gingold), costume sketches for the women, cast listings for the Broadway, London, operatic and film versions, capsule bios of Wheeler, Sondheim and Jonathan Tunick (orchestrator, who also wrote an admirable introduction to this volume), and a discography current to about 1990. I recently saw an excellent professional production of “A Little Night Music” so I decided to read it, because I knew the libretto and Sondheim’s lyrics would be worth reexamining. I was correct in that assumption. Reading it made me appreciate the performance I had seen even more.The libretto (book) by Hugh Wheeler is one of the best I have encountered in a musical. Good characterization, a nice flow from scene to scene, and unlike the book of many musicals, the story feels complete with the songs, not merely a tool for them.Something that I noticed in reading “A Little Night Music” that I did not catch fully in performance is the juxtaposition of the two scenes, which follow one another that contain the songs “Send in the Clowns” and “The Miler’s Son.” It is brilliant. The former scene/song explores the idea of not taking what you need/want when it is presented to you and being passed by and made a fool (or clown). The scene/song “The Miler’s Son” is just the opposite. Life will make a fool of you from time to time, so you have to jump at any chance and happiness that you can get when presented. This thematic device is simply presented in very effective dialogue, and in the two most profound lyrics/songs of the piece.Read “A Little Night Music” and then see a good production.
